Output 29d3bd66868a23a58f3f6f8f585a2c6aae4fdb0633d741ff9d2b82279c19c2e6:0

value
149843816
script pubkey
OP_0 OP_PUSHBYTES_20 03c73fe80bf204aeabc484dc4885ede3a3ad25a8
address
bc1qq0rnl6qt7gz2a27ysnwy3p0duw366fdg4wxtuq
transaction
29d3bd66868a23a58f3f6f8f585a2c6aae4fdb0633d741ff9d2b82279c19c2e6
confirmations
168910
spent
true